Ambassador Tatiana Rosito
Secretary for International Affairs, Ministry of Finance, Government of Brazil
Ambassador Tatiana Rosito has served as Secretary for International Affairs at the Ministry of Finance since January 2023, where she coordinates the G20 Finance Track and manages relations with countries, blocs, and international economic and financial organizations. Tatiana is a career economist and diplomat with over 25 years of experience in the public sector and international organizations.
She spent more than twelve years in Asia, where she served as Senior Consultant at the New Development Bank (2020–2022), Chief Representative of Petrobras in China, and General Manager for Business Development in Asia (2017–2019). Prior to that, she was Minister-Counselor at the Brazilian Embassy in Beijing (2009–2014) and Counselor at the Brazilian Embassy in Singapore (2006–2009), working primarily in trade and economic-financial affairs.
As a Brazilian delegate to the United Nations (2003–2004), she worked in the Second Committee (economic and financial issues), representing Brazil in negotiations on the then-Millennium Development Goals, development financing, poverty reduction, South-South cooperation, the international financial system, and UN executive agencies.
In Brazil (2014–2017), she served as Executive Secretary of the Foreign Trade Chamber of the Presidency (CAMEX) and as Special Advisor to the Ministers of Planning and Finance. At the Ministry of Finance, she collaborated with other government sectors and the private sector to define Brazil’s NDC in the context of the climate change negotiations that led to the Paris Agreement (2015). Previously, she was Advisor to the Chief Minister of the Civil House (1999–2002).
Tatiana is a Senior Fellow at the Brazilian Center for International Relations (CEBRI), where she founded and led the China Analysis Group until 2020. She is an invited member of the advisory committee of the Brazil-China Business Council. She holds a master’s degree in International Development from the Harvard Kennedy School and an Executive MBA from INSEAD and Tsinghua University. She earned her undergraduate degree in Economics from UFRJ and completed a specialization at UnB.
